Abstract

The following report, in the form of a letter to Dr. C. W. Mayo, Postgraduate Medicine's editor-in-chief, comes from Dr. Charles S. Houston, an internist family doctor from Aspen, Colorado, who served as director of the Peace Corps program in India from September 1962 to December 1964. Dr. Houston now is special assistant to Sargent Shriver, director of the Peace Corps, and is in charge of planning for the new Peace Corps volunteer doctor program.
